Transaction d664ea08c93576cd834170c7545b913a35c38ca7e9b061c2052edd3c80331f57
1 Input
1 Output
-
d664ea08c93576cd834170c7545b913a35c38ca7e9b061c2052edd3c80331f57:0
- value
- 2791540
- script pubkey
- OP_0 OP_PUSHBYTES_20 0debe617edc553b5cdd84cbf6e969f3c2d2a4816
- address
- bc1qph47v9ldc4fmtnwcfjlka95l8skj5jqk0qlr69